In this episode, Nate Snyder and Adam Brown talk about recent developments in sports. They start with a discussion of the types of clients we represent at FMJ Law, from owners and athletes to conferences, leagues, teams, and local associations. Nate and Adam also talk about the Minnesota Timberwolves ownership changes, including legal issues, sale structure, disputes, and arbitration. And they talk about the NBA’s possible expansion into Europe, private equity and its increased involvement in college and professional sports, and developments in the WNBA.
